How do I know the property needs rewiring?
Signs include brittle or cloth-style cables, frequent breaker trips, warm sockets, or lights that flicker. Many older homes and lodges in Vic Falls were never designed for today’s loads — testing confirms what must be replaced.

Will you integrate my inverter or generator safely?
Absolutely. We separate backup circuits, fit a compliant changeover/ATS, and set neutral/earth arrangements so there’s no back-feed into ZETDC. Everything is labelled for easy use.

What protections do you include on new installs?
Proper earthing and bonding, RCD/RCBO protection, and surge protection at the DB. Victoria Falls’ storms and return-of-supply spikes make this essential.

How long does a typical rewire take?
A small home can be 2–4 days; larger properties or busy lodges take longer. We phase the work to minimise downtime and test as we go.
